Trial Information
Summary: Anemia- cancer
Queens Hospital Center is currently recruiting subjects to
participate in an experimental study for treating anemia in cancer
subjects.
Study drug and procedures will be made available to you at no
cost.
To qualify, you must:
- Be 18 years of age or older
- Have anemia resulting from cancer, chemotherapy, or
radiotherapy
- Be stable for 1 month before the study starts
- Have a life expectancy of 9 months or greater based on the
judgement of the investigator
- Not have acute or chronic leukemia
- Not have received chemotherapy or radiotherapy within 30 days
of the start of the study
- Not have anemia resulting from factors other than cancer or
cancer therapy
- Not be pregnant or breastfeeding
- Not have a history of uncontrolled seizures
- Not have an acute illness requiring hospitalization within 7
days of the start of the study
